How C++ assignment help can Save You Time, Stress, and Money.



In a few variations of Visual Studio (and possibly other compilers) There's a bug that is admittedly irritating and isn't going to sound right. So in case you declare/determine your swap purpose such as this:

const X* const p signifies “p is usually a const pointer to an X that may be const”: you'll be able to’t change the pointer p

The closing curly brace signifies the top of the code for the main perform. Based on the C99 specification and newer, the key purpose, in contrast to some other functionality, will implicitly return a value of 0 on achieving the that terminates the operate.

Allow’s get a quick look at the options in the CodeLite editor – from syntax colouring to keyboard shortcuts. CodeLite will make gentle function of making C initiatives on Home windows and OS X.

A expectations-compliant and portably published C method is usually compiled for an incredibly wide range of Personal computer platforms and operating devices with couple adjustments to its supply code. The language happens to be obtainable on an exceptionally big selection of platforms, from embedded microcontrollers to supercomputers.

The trailing const on inspect() member perform should be accustomed to suggest the method gained’t improve the object’s abstract

If This system makes an attempt to accessibility an uninitialized price, the results are undefined. Lots of modern day compilers try and detect and alert about this problem, but the two Fake positives and Wrong negatives can happen.

The copy assignment operator differs with the copy constructor in that it should clear up the info users of your assignment's focus on (and properly handle self-assignment) Whilst the copy constructor assigns values to uninitialized info associates.[1] By way of example:

Sorry, we just ought useful link to ensure you're not a robot. For best effects, be sure to make certain your browser is accepting cookies.

In scenarios in which code have to be compilable by possibly regular-conforming or K&R C-based mostly compilers, the __STDC__ macro may be used to split the code into Common and K&R sections to prevent the use over a K&R C-based compiler of characteristics readily available only in Common C.

would be modified. You find yourself needing to adorn your code which has a few more keystrokes (the visit this site const search phrase), Together with the

in C++, How am i able to give a class duplicate constructor and assignment operator precisely the same functionality with out making replicate code 0

The angle brackets encompassing stdio.h show that stdio.h is found employing a look for technique that prefers headers presented Along with the compiler to other headers obtaining precisely the same name, as opposed to double quotations which generally involve nearby or undertaking-distinct header files.

One of many aims on the C standardization method was to create a superset of K&R C, incorporating most of the subsequently released unofficial characteristics. The standards committee also incorporated various further capabilities like operate prototypes (borrowed from C++), void ideas, assist for Worldwide character sets and locales, and preprocessor enhancements.

Leave a Reply

Your email address will not be published. Required fields are marked *